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

A fuel filler system for use in a vehicle is provided. The system includes a fuel filler tube, a locking bracket coupled to an inner surface of the fuel filler tube, and a closure device coupleable within the tube end and including an outer wall and a radially movable tab extending from the outer wall. The tab engages the locking bracket after rotation of the closure device from a first rotational position to a second rotational position to prevent rotation of the closure device relative to the locking bracket. The closure device further includes a web flexibly connecting the tab to the outer wall and a region of weakness defined in the web, such that upon forcible rotation of the closure device from the second rotational position to the first rotational position, the region of weakness facilitates separation of the web from the outer wall.

What is claimed is: 1. A fuel filler system for use in a vehicle, said system comprising: a fuel filler tube including an inner surface and a tube end; a locking bracket coupled to the inner surface of said fuel filler tube at least partially within said tube end, wherein said locking bracket includes a first end and a second end; and a closure device coupleable within said tube end and including an outer wall and a radially movable tab extending from said outer wall, wherein said radially movable tab engages at least one of said first end and said second end of said locking bracket after rotation of said closure device from a first rotational position relative to said locking bracket to a second rotational position relative to said locking bracket to prevent rotation of said closure device relative to said locking bracket, said closure device further comprising a web flexibly connecting said radially movable tab to said outer wall and a region of weakness defined in said web, such that upon forcible rotation of said closure device from said second rotational position to said first rotational position, said region of weakness facilitates separation of said web from said outer wall. 2. The fuel filler system in accordance with claim 1 , wherein said radially movable tab is configured to deflect inwardly during at least one of insertion of said closure device into said tube end and rotation of said closure device from the first rotational position to the second rotational position. 3. The fuel filler system in accordance with claim 1 , wherein said radially movable tab is configured to accommodate dimensional variations in said locking bracket. 4. The fuel filler system in accordance with claim 1 , said closure device further comprising a tether member that flexibly couples at least one of said web and said radially movable tab to said outer wall. 5. The fuel filler system in accordance with claim 4 , wherein said tether member couples said radially movable tab to said outer wall even when said radially movable tab is no longer coupled to said outer wall by said web. 6. The fuel filler system in accordance with claim 1 , said closure device further comprising an insertion limiting structure for precluding over insertion of said closure device into said fuel filler tube. 7. The fuel filler system in accordance with claim 6 , wherein said insertion limiting structure comprises at least one flange extending from said outer wall of said closure device. 8. A closure device for use in a capless fuel filler system, the capless fuel filler system including a fuel filler tube, said closure device comprising: a first surface that includes an opening defined therein; a pivotable door hingedly coupled to said first surface and configured to selectively cover said opening; an outer wall extending from said first surface; a radially movable tab extending from said outer wall, wherein said radially movable tab engages a portion of the fuel filler tube after rotation of said closure device from a first rotational position relative to the fuel filler tube to a second rotational position relative to the fuel filler tube to prevent rotation of said closure device relative to the fuel filler tube; a web flexibly connecting said radially movable tab to said outer wall; and a region of weakness defined in said web, such that upon forcible rotation of said closure device from the second rotational position to the first rotational position, said region of weakness facilitates separation of said radially movable tab from said outer wall. 9. The closure device in accordance with claim 8 , wherein said radially movable tab is configured to deflect inwardly during at least one of insertion of said closure device into an end of the fuel filler tube and rotation of said closure device from the first rotational position to the second rotational position. 10. The closure device in accordance with claim 8 , wherein said radially movable tab is configured to accommodate dimensional variations in the fuel filler tube. 11. The closure device in accordance with claim 8 , said closure device further comprising a tether member that flexibly couples at least one of said web and said radially movable tab to said outer wall. 12. The closure device in accordance with claim 11 , wherein said tether member couples said radially movable tab to said outer wall even when said radially movable tab is no longer coupled to said outer wall by said web. 13. The closure device in accordance with claim 8 , said closure device further comprising an insertion limiting structure for precluding over insertion of said closure device into the fuel filler tube. 14. The closure device in accordance with claim 13 , wherein said insertion limiting structure comprises at least one flange extending from said outer wall of said closure device.
